色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

MySQL查詢語句的優化方法

老白2年前12瀏覽0評論

摘要:MySQL是一種常用的關系型數據庫管理系統,但在大數據量和高并發的情況下,查詢效率可能會受到影響。本文將介紹一些,以提高查詢效率。

1. 索引優化

索引是MySQL查詢語句的重要優化手段之一。通過創建合適的索引,可以大大提高查詢效率。常見的索引類型有B樹索引、哈希索引等。在創建索引時,需要考慮哪些字段需要建立索引,以及索引的類型和長度等。也需要定期維護索引,避免索引失效或占用過多的空間。

2. SQL語句優化

SQL語句的優化也是提高MySQL查詢效率的重要手段。在編寫SQL語句時,需要避免使用不必要的子查詢、多個JOIN操作等,盡可能簡化SQL語句。另外,可以使用EXPLAIN語句分析SQL語句的執行計劃,以找出可能存在的性能問題。

3. 數據庫表優化

數據庫表的優化也可以提高MySQL查詢效率。在創建表時,需要考慮表的結構和類型,避免使用過多的TEXT和BLOB類型,以及盡可能減少表的列數。也需要定期清理無用的數據和索引,以減少表的大小和查詢的時間。

4. 緩存優化

cached、Redis等緩存服務,將查詢結果緩存起來,以減少查詢的次數和時間。也需要定期清理緩存,避免緩存過期或占用過多的內存。

綜上所述,通過索引優化、SQL語句優化、數據庫表優化和緩存優化,可以提高MySQL查詢效率,從而滿足大數據量和高并發的應用需求。